freespeachplease!..........there's no such thing as a hardship allowance within BA mainline either.....I should know I've been on long haul with BA for 9 years..
We aren't paid hourly when downroute, but are paid meal allowances according to cost of food in hotels/cost of living & these varied according to country visited. Yes, ALA & BAK were good payers, but take into account that a cup of coffee in the ALA Hyatt cost US$6.50 at the time & that the food outside the hotel was pretty dire & just as expensive. On the opposite end of the scale.....when Harare was at LGW we just about scraped £7 a day!! Roll on 24 hour flight pay!!
